Canadians capture 5-2, 4-3 hockey wins

Utah County is next


In a well played and exciting men's ice hockey series, the Langley Senior Chiefs from British Columbia, Canada edged the host Sun Valley Suns 5-2 and 4-3 last Friday and Saturday at Sun Valley Skating Center. Power-play goals by Bryan O'Connell and Ryan Enrico kept the Suns close Friday night, but Langley stretched its early 2-0 and 3-1 leads into the 5-2 victory. Suns goalie Ryan Thomson stopped 39 of 44 shots. It was Sun Valley's first home loss.

The Suns (7-3-0) got two goals by defenseman Bryan Winkler in the first period Saturday, but Langley had three of its own in the same 20 minutes. A pretty two-on-one between Jamie Ellison and goal scorer Chad Levitan pulled the Suns to within one goal at 4-3 in the third period, but that's the way the score remained.

Saturday's game was a benefit for Sun Valley Adaptive Sports.

The Suns resume action Friday and Saturday, Jan. 28-29 against the Utah County Blizzard from Provo. Opening faceoffs are 7 p.m. each night on resort ice. Saturday's game benefits Sun Valley Pony Club.

Sun Valley hosted the same Utah Blizzard team over New Year's weekend and swept a 6-5 and 2-1 set.
